Nobody is avoiding it.  In the title of your thread, you seem to be addressing anybody who doesn't believe the Koran is the word of God.  But your post makes it obvious that you are addressing Bible believers.  So the answer to your question is obvious. 

If one believes the Bible is the word of God, one can't also believe that the Koran is also the word of God, because both texts contradict each other.  The Bible says that Jesus is the son of God, while the Koran says that Jesus is not the son of God.  The Bible says that Jesus died for our sins, while the Koran says that Jesus did not die at all.
